This afternoon I saw two male Bobolinks in a Weber County/Ogden Valley location that I haven't seen reported in the past--one mile west of the entrance to the Middle Fork WMA. The birds were singing over a field and landing on irrigation equipment on the north side of 1900N about a tenth of a mile east of SR-166 as I was headed toward the Middle Fork. The field is across the road from a house with a fish-shaped mailbox and wrought iron horse-and-carriage sign that says Rasley 7083. Has anyone else ever seen them there?
The "other" historic Bobolink location in the valley is approximately 2 miles south of the Middle Fork WMA on the east side of the road.
